Why can't electric cars run far in winter? Don't neglect the main causes

As soon as winter comes, do many people who ride electric vehicles find that it's easy for them to run not far in winter, and the electricity will be gone soon after not riding for a long time, do you know what causes it? Do you know what's the culprit for the short distance of electric vehicles in winter?

1. Lower temperatures can cause a drop in the mileage of electric vehicles.

This is a normal phenomenon. After the year, the temperature will rise and the driving mileage will recover. The most suitable temperature for electric vehicle battery is 25-35 degrees. The lower the temperature, the weaker the battery's charging and discharging ability. If the temperature drops to 0 ℃ or below, the driving mileage of electric vehicles can be shortened by one third to one half. If the ambient temperature reaches - 15 ℃, the battery will almost lose the ability of charge and discharge. It is a normal phenomenon that the weather suddenly turns cold in winter and the driving mileage of electric vehicle drops, not necessarily because of electric vehicle or battery failure.

2. The load quality has a great influence on the driving mileage of electric vehicles.

The electric vehicle is a light and efficient design. The load weight of the two wheel electric vehicle is usually 100 kg, which is slightly larger than the normal weight of an adult. If the load of the human load is too heavy, the driving mileage will also drop a lot.

3. The driving speed also has a great influence on the driving mileage of electric vehicles.

We all know that the higher the speed of the car, the higher the fuel consumption, the same is true for electric vehicles. There is also an economic speed. Generally, the economic speed of 350 Watt and 500 Watt motors is 20 and 30 kilometers respectively. The mileage data given by the manufacturer is also tested within the economic speed, and we usually use the highest speed when driving electric vehicles, so we often fail to reach the longest mileage declared by the manufacturer.

4. Other common reasons.

For example, the driving resistance caused by insufficient tire air pressure and low air pressure is too large, the brake of electric vehicle is too tight or the brake is not fully returned, the road condition is not good, resulting in frequent acceleration and deceleration and braking, too many ramps, driving against the wind, etc.

The mileage of electric vehicle is not only determined by the battery, but also reflects the battery capacity of electric vehicle and the matching of motor and controller. It is also one of the reference standards for users to evaluate the quality of an electric vehicle. For many users, especially the new electric vehicle, if the mileage can not meet their own requirements, it is often attributed to the poor battery quality or electric vehicle quality problems, and just ignored the use of the environment on the driving mileage of the electric vehicle this important factor. The battery problem is mainly reflected in the fact that the driving mileage is significantly shorter than before under the condition of constant use environment. Customers should take this experience standard as a reference to find out the battery with real problems in time.
